Abstract
The work is designed to develop the pick and place robotic arm with a soft catching gripper that to lift hazardous object which cannot not be touched by human hands.The robot is controlled through Bluetooth using smartphone.It is built with servo motors. Arduino controller is used in robotic arm process ,the movement of the robot is either forward,backward,left or right.The robotic arm is designed using servo motors,and it is interfaced with micro controller.The main advantage of soft catching gripper is to lift a hazardous object.it is controlled by using Bluetooth in smart phone.
